Yes! Depositors’ interest bearing accounts totaling $250,000 or less at Sturdy Savings Bank, an FDIC insured Bank, are fully insured. Depositors with more than $250,000 at Sturdy can still be fully insured, provided the accounts meet certain requirements. We can help you calculate your insurance coverage using the FDIC’s online Electronic Deposit Insurance Estimator. In addition, all non-interest bearing deposit accounts will receive unlimited coverage through December 31, 2012.
